Is Mio Strawberry Watermelon Dairy Free?

Description
Concentrated liquid flavor offers a bright strawberry-watermelon taste with a syrupy texture; users commonly add a few drops to plain or sparkling water, iced tea, cocktails, or mocktails. Reviews note strong, long-lasting sweetness, convenient portability, occasional dispenser leaks, an artificial aftertaste reported by some customers, and noticeable vivid coloring effects.

Ingredients
WATER, MALIC ACID, GUM ARABIC, CITRIC ACID, CONTAINS LESS THAN 2% OF NATURAL FLAVOR, SUCRALOSE AND ACESULFAME POTASSIUM (SWEETENERS), POTASSIUM CITRATE, SUCROSE ACETATE ISOBUTYRATE, RED 40, POTASSIUM SORBATE (PRESERVATIVE).
What is a Dairy Free diet?
A dairy-free diet eliminates all foods made from or containing milk and milk-derived ingredients, such as butter, cheese, yogurt, and cream. It's essential for people with lactose intolerance, milk allergies, or those who prefer plant-based alternatives. Common dairy substitutes include almond, soy, oat, and coconut-based milks and cheeses. While dairy is a major source of calcium and vitamin D, these nutrients can be replaced through fortified foods or supplements. Many people find going dairy-free helps reduce digestive issues, acne, or inflammation, but balance and proper nutrient intake remain key for long-term health.
